Product Description:
This compound is primarily utilized in the field of biochemistry and pharmacology due to its structural similarity to tryptophan, an essential amino acid. It is often employed in research studies to investigate the biosynthesis and metabolism of tryptophan-related compounds. Additionally, it serves as a precursor in the synthesis of various bioactive molecules, including potential pharmaceutical agents targeting neurological disorders. Its indole moiety makes it valuable in the development of compounds with potential antioxidant, anti-inflammatory, or neuroprotective properties. Researchers also explore its role in modulating serotonin pathways, which could have implications for treating mood disorders or other serotonin-related conditions.
